What is Mesh Material?

At its core, mesh material consists of a network of interconnected strands or fibers, typically made from synthetic materials such as polyester or nylon. This design allows for greater airflow and breathability while providing flexibility and comfort for the wearer. Mesh materials have become a staple in various types of footwear, including athletic shoes, casual sneakers, and even certain types of dress shoes.

Benefits of Mesh Material in Shoes

When considering what mesh material for shoes offers, several advantages arise:

  • Breathability: One of the key features of mesh is its ability to allow air to circulate, keeping feet cool and dry during intense activities.
  • Lightweight: Mesh shoes are generally lighter than those made from heavier materials, making them more comfortable for extended wear.
  • Flexibility: The construction of mesh materials allows for greater movement, adapting easily to the foot’s shape during various activities.
  • Quick Drying: Mesh dries quickly compared to traditional materials, making it ideal for use in wet conditions.

Types of Mesh Used in Footwear

There are several types of mesh material for shoes, each designed for different performance needs:

1. Knit Mesh

Knit mesh has become increasingly popular due to its stretchable nature and ability to provide a snug fit. It is commonly used in running shoes and lifestyle footwear.

2. Monomesh

This type of mesh is characterized by its tightly woven threads that offer durability while still maintaining breathability. It's often found in sports shoes that require long-lasting wear.

3. Air Mesh

Air mesh features larger holes that enhance airflow and are particularly effective in hot weather. This material is prevalent in athletic shoes designed for outdoor activities.

The Future of Mesh in Footwear

As consumer preferences evolve, manufacturers are increasingly utilizing advanced mesh technology. Innovations such as waterproof mesh, which retains breathability, are on the horizon. Furthermore, sustainable mesh materials using recycled plastics are being developed to meet eco-conscious demands.
